AWARD This appeal is preferred by the appellant insurance company as against the award dated 23.01.2012 passed by the Motor Accident Claims Tribunal, Tribunal, Chief Judicial Magistrate, Thiruvannamalai in MCOP.No.69 of 2010.
2. The learned counsel for the appellant submitted that the appellant insurance company agreed to satisfy the award passed by the Tribunal. In view of the same, the award of the Tribunal at Rs.15,000/-(Rupees Fifteen Thousand only) with interest at the rate of 7.5% per annum from the date of filing of claim petition, is hereby confirmed. 3.Hence, the appellant insurance company is directed to deposit the entire award amount with interest and costs, after deducting the amount if any already deposited, within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this award. On such deposit being made, the Tribunal is directed to transfer the same to the first respondent/claimant, on proper identification through RTGS in accordance with the terms of the award, without insisting on any formal permission petition.
4.Accordingly, the Civil Miscellaneous Appeal is disposed of. Consequently, connected Miscellaneous Petition is closed.
